Notice
Recent Posts
Recent Comments
Link
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 | 31 |
Tags
- NavGraph
- onResume()
- 가시성
- 프래그먼트
- 열거
- MVVM
- Navigation component
- onStop()
- onPause()
- configuration change
- onStart()
- Backing property
- 깃허브
- onCreate()
- ViewModel
- Navgivation
- UI controller
- IntArray
- LiveData
- Navigation Graph
- onSaveInstanceState()
- Bundle
- fragment
- LifecycleOwner
- onRestart()
- arcitecture
- onDestory()
- TransactionTooLargeException
- 풀리퀘스트
- pullrequest
Archives
- Today
- Total
목록onRestart() (1)
밑빠진 지식에 블로그 쓰기
모든 액티비티는 생명주기를 가지고 있다. 탄생 부터 죽음 까지 처음 생성되어 초기화 될때부터 파괴되고 시스템에서 메모리를 회수할 떄까지 다양한 상태로 구성된다. 유저가 앱을 시작할때, 액티비티 사이를 이동할때 앱에서 나가고 들어올때, 액티비티의 상태가 변경됩니다. 우리는 이렇게 상태가 변경될때 어떤 동작을 하고 싶습니다. 즉 코드를 실행 시키고 싶다. 그러기 위해서는 생명주기 콜백 함수를 구현 해야한다. 액티비티 상태가 변경 될때 안드로이드 시스템(운영체제)가 콜백함수를 호출한다. onCreate() : 액티비티에 대한 초기화를 해야하는 곳 레이아웃을 inflate합니다. => 인플레이트 문서 만들기( 인플레이트란 무엇인가) 클릭리스너를 정의합니다. 뷰바인딩을 설정합니다. onCreate() 실행된 후에..
카테고리 없음
2023. 3. 16. 22:24